"Journey Back to CandyLand"


AN ORIGINAL OPERA
WRITTEN AND PRODUCED BY FOURTH GRADERS
 
AT MADISON STATION ELEMENTARY SCHOOL
 

 
February 12, 2008, 7:00 p.m.
The Performing Arts Center
 Madison Central High School
   
                

THE COMPANY is made up of 65 fourth graders in Mrs. Hardin's homeoom class
and Mrs. Gober's intellectually gifted classes. These students contracted for jobs such as electrician, carpenter, set designer, makeup artist, costume designer, historian, public relations agent, stage managers , performer, composer, and production manager.
THE STORY
"Journey Back to CandyLand"
opens with CandyLand's Mayor Pep R. Mint explaining a childhood loss. His cousin, Twix, vanished years earlier, when the two discovered a mysterious game called "CityLand".

ACT ONE

Molly Pop, the only daughter of Mayor Pep R. Mint, accidentally finds the mysterious board game in her basement. Curious about the "Big City", Molly Pop convinces her friends, Starburst and Gumdrop, to play the game with her.
With the roll of a die, the girls are magically transported to the Big City.

ACT TWO

Molly Pop, Starburst and Gumdrop arrive in the Big City where they meet Mr. Twix and his associate, Knuckles.  Posing as the head of  the Big City's Official Tourist Welcoming Comittee, Mr. Twix tries to trick the girls into taking him back to CandyLand with them.  He wants revenge, but ends up learning an important lesson about love and trust.







THE CHARACTERS

Pep R. Mint - The mayor of CandyLand, Pep R. Mint, is a proud father and public servant who has dedicated his life to protecting the people of CandyLand from suffering the same fate as his Cousin Twix

 

Molly Pop – The mayor’s daughter, daring Molly Pop longs for adventure in theBig City.  She is a loyal friend to Starburst and Gumdrop.               

 

Starburst – Molly Pop’s friend Starburst loves to eat candy.  She is ready for an adventure in CityLand as long as there are sweets to eat.  She can’t imagine eating fruits and vegetables!

 

Gumdrop – Gumdrop is also Molly Pop’s friend.  She is apprehensive about CityLand, but she adores fashion, and the Big City is full of the newest designs.

 

Mr. Twix – Cousin to the mayor of CandyLand, Mr. Twix is a bitter character who holds a grudge against the people of Candyland.  He has an important lesson to learn about his family. 

 

Knuckles – Mr. Twix has a minion, and his name is Knuckles.  Working for Mr. Twix is a challenge to Knuckles, who usually has trouble figuring things out.
